Etymology
Beatris-Elena combines two names: Beatris derives from the Latin "Beatrix," meaning "she who brings happiness" (from "beatus," blessed), while Elena comes from the Greek "Helene," meaning "bright" or "shining" (from "helios," sun). This compound name is used primarily in Romance and Germanic cultures, particularly in Spanish, Portuguese, Italian, and Eastern European contexts, with roots in Christian tradition where both component names appear in medieval and classical hagiography.
